Towerstone Acquires Ohio Wholesale Insurance Broker Jacobs & Associates
Towerstone, a Dallas-based wholesale insurance division of IMA Financial Group, has acquired Jacobs & Associates, a general agent and excess and surplus lines broker based in Strongsville, Ohio. The transaction was effective April 1, 2021. Lloyd’s to Exit U.S. Admitted Market, Focus on U.S. Surplus Lines, Reinsurance
Lloyd’s announced it plans to stop accepting admitted market accounts in the U.S. in a year and focus on the U.S. reinsurance and excess and surplus (E&S) insurance market, where it is the market leader.
